Quick Stats (2025)
- Grades: 7-12, PG
- Enrollment: 240 students
- Yearly Tuition (Boarding Students): $53,900
- Acceptance rate: 70%
- Average class size: 11 students
- Application Deadline: None / Rolling
- Source: Verified school update

School Notes
- All-male college-prep boarding school
- Stringent academics with more than 50 course offerings
- Honors, Advanced Placement, Dual Enrollment courses
- Curriculum includes Aerospace and Marine Science options
- Opportunities to receive a nomination to a US ServiceAcademy
- 40 acres dedicated to US Marine Corps styled LeadershipEnhancement Development course featuring a rappel tower, 3rockclimbing walls, high ropes challenge, paintball course,obsticle course, mud course, and more
- 18 competitive sports and additional extracurricularactivities
- Moral, spiritual opportunities through civic-minded clubs:Rotary Interact, KEY, National Honor Society, Boy Scouts,non-denominational Vespers, (FCA) Fellowship of ChristianAthletes
- Marine Corps Junior Reserve Officers' Training Corps(JROTC)
- International Student Body
- Marine Military Academy accreditations: Southern Association of Colleges and Schools; Member of the College Board; Association of Military Colleges and Schools of the United States; Texas and National Association for College Admission Counseling; The Association of Boarding Schools

Frequently Asked Questions
How much does Marine Military Academy cost?
Marine Military Academy's tuition is approximately $53,900 for boarding students.
What is the acceptance rate of Marine Military Academy?
The acceptance rate of Marine Military Academy is 70%, which is higher than the boarding school average of 64%.
What sports does Marine Military Academy offer?
Marine Military Academy offers 14 interscholastic sports: Baseball, Basketball, Boxing, Cross Country Running, Football, Golf, Riflery, Soccer, Swimming, Swimming and Diving, Tennis, Track, Track and Field and Volleyball.
Does Marine Military Academy offer a summer program?
Yes, Marine Military Academy offers a summer program. Visit their summer school page for more information.
What is Marine Military Academy's ranking?
Marine Military Academy ranks among the top 20 boarding schools for High percentage of boarding students.
When is the application deadline for Marine Military Academy?
The application deadline for Marine Military Academy is rolling (applications are reviewed as they are received year-round).
